导读 在数字图像处理领域,图像搜索是一项重要任务,它帮助我们快速找到与目标图像相似的内容。而利用OpenCV结合直方图特征进行图像搜索,是一种...
在数字图像处理领域,图像搜索是一项重要任务,它帮助我们快速找到与目标图像相似的内容。而利用OpenCV结合直方图特征进行图像搜索,是一种高效且实用的方法。🧐
直方图是描述图像颜色分布的重要工具,通过计算图像的颜色或灰度值频率,可以捕捉到图像的整体特征。例如,一张风景照片和一张人像照片往往具有截然不同的直方图特征。利用OpenCV中的`cv2.calcHist()`函数,我们可以轻松计算图像的直方图,并使用`cv2.compareHist()`来比较两幅图像之间的相似性。🎯
这种方法的优势在于不仅速度快,还能有效应对光照变化等问题。比如,在电商平台上,用户上传一张商品图片后,系统能够迅速从海量库存中匹配出最接近的商品,提升用户体验。🛒✨
总之,借助OpenCV和直方图技术,图像搜索变得更加智能化与便捷化,为我们的日常生活带来了更多便利!💡